MgSnPt2 is an intermetallic compound combining magnesium, tin, and platinum in a fixed stoichiometric ratio. This is a research-phase material in the lightweight intermetallic family, of primary interest for exploratory metallurgical studies rather than established industrial production. The combination of magnesium's light weight with platinum and tin suggests potential applications in high-performance aerospace or advanced catalytic systems, though practical engineering use remains limited pending further development of processing routes and property characterization.
